WHAT IS A FAT TIRE E-BIKE?

Fat tire e-bikes are defined by their wide tires (typically 4.0 inches or more). These tires excel at:

  • Stability on sand, gravel, snow, and trails

  • Smoother rides across uneven terrain

  • Extra grip and balance

COMFORT, HANDLING & RIDING EXPERIENCE

Fat Tire E-Bike Comfort

Fat tire bikes like the BK9S absorb bumps and rough patches comfortably thanks to wide tires. This makes longer rides feel less jarring especially when pavement ends and trail begins.

City E-Bike Comfort

City e-bikes are tuned for smooth, efficient rides on flat roads. Riders often enjoy more responsive steering and lighter handling ideal for quick navigation through town.

Quick Comparison:

  • Fat Tire: Cushioned feel, stable, rugged

  • City E-Bike: Nimble, lighter steering, speed-oriented

PERFORMANCE: HILLS, TERRAIN & SPEED

Hills & Terrain

Fat tire models generally perform better on varied landscapes, giving extra traction when climbing dirt inclines or grassy paths.

City e-bikes do fine on moderate inclines but are optimized for flat rides.

Speed

Both fat tire and city e-bikes are usually limited to legal speed caps (~25 km/h), but city e-bikes often feel a bit quicker on smooth roads simply because they’re lighter and more streamlined.

Summary:

  • Fat Tire: Better traction and control off-road

  • City E-Bike: Efficient and agile on paved roads

PORTABILITY & EVERYDAY PRACTICALITY

Fat Tire E-Bikes

They’re heavier, bigger, and harder to fold or lift. Great if you plan to keep it in a garage or backyard.

City E-Bikes

Designed for daily use easy to fold, carry up stairs, fit into cars, or stow in tight spaces.

If practicality and storage matter more than off-road versatility, city e-bikes win here.
